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 47161 zip code. The total population is 3410, of which, 1840 are male and 1570 are female. With a total area of 57.18 square miles, the population density is 57.8 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 43.6 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 47161 zip code is $80750. This is 8.00% greater than the national average. This income places 13%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$18118. Education

In the 47161 zip code, 93.1%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 16.2%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 47161 zip, there are an estimated 1665 people in the labor force, of which, 1606 are employed, and 59 are unemployed. There are a total of 0 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 31 minutes. Of the total people that work, 131 worked from home and 1533 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 40.4. Housing

The median home value for the 47161 zip code is 171000. There is an estimated  1163 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$980 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$967.
